- registration
- nounADJECTIVE▪ full▪ limited▪ formal▪ compulsory, mandatory▪ complimentary, free▪
a complimentary registration for the 2002 meeting of the society
▪ advance▪ same-day (AmE)▪states that allow same-day voter registration
▪ on-site (AmE)▪on-site registration for this week's events
▪ online▪ civil▪civil registration of births
▪ birth, death (both esp. BrE)▪ class, course, student▪ voter▪ car, company (BrE), domain-name, gun, land, product, trademark, vehicle▪ VAT (BrE)▪ conference, convention, meeting▪ party (AmE)▪my Democratic party registration
VERB + REGISTRATION▪ require▪ apply for, file, seek, submit▪ conduct (AmE)▪The organization will conduct voter registration for overseas nationals.
▪ obtain, receive▪ accept, grant sb▪Under the new regulation we can grant full registration to foreign lawyers.
▪ renew▪ cancelREGISTRATION + VERB▪ be requiredREGISTRATION + NOUN▪ requirement▪a failure to comply with the registration requirements
▪ period▪ deadline▪The registration deadline is November 4.
▪ procedure, process▪ scheme (BrE), system▪ database, records▪I traced my family history using the civil registration records.
▪ list, roll (both AmE)▪the information on the registration roll
▪ application, form▪ card, document, papers▪ statement▪ number▪I gave the registration number of the car to the police. (BrE)
▪You must have the voter registration number on the form. (AmE)
▪ plate (BrE) (license plate in AmE)▪The police are looking for a black car with German registration plates.
▪ sticker (AmE)▪ officer (BrE)▪ fee▪ counter (AmE), desk, office▪I headed to the registration desk to find out where the talk was.
▪ campaign, drive▪a voter registration campaign
PREPOSITION▪ on registration▪You will receive a free CD on registration with the club.
▪ registration as▪registration as a political party
▪ registration by▪the registration of the vehicle by the appropriate authority
▪ registration for▪Registration for this event ends on December 10.
▪ registration with▪Registration with the council is compulsory.
PHRASES▪ an application for registration (esp. BrE)▪ a certificate of registration
